Want to see top notch classical musicians performing at the gorgeous Berkeley City Club, which is normally a private club, but open to the public on this rare occassion.

The Claude Heater Foundation presents a musical recital co-presented with the Harmony Project Bay Area featuring San Francisco Symphony first violinist Sarn Oliver, and classical/world music artist Misha Khalikulov, lead cello teacher at Harmony Project.
